Breitling Superocean vs. Superocean Heritage: Which Dive Watch?

Superocean and Superocean Heritage share a maritime purpose but answer it differently: the former emphasizes modern dive-watch clarity and a 300 m rating, while the latter combines 1957-inspired design with Manufacture Calibre B31 and a sleeker 200 m case.

The numerical comparison uses two exact 42 mm steel-bracelet references: Superocean Automatic 42 A17375211B1A1 and Superocean Heritage B31 Automatic 42 AB3111241B1A1.

Water capability

Three hundred meters versus two hundred meters

A17375211B1A1 carries the higher factory rating at 300 m. It also uses a screw-locked crown with two gaskets and a unidirectional ratcheted bezel, the conventional safety direction for elapsed-time diving.

AB3111241B1A1 is rated to 200 m and uses the same crown and bezel directions in its official specification. Its lower number does not make it decorative-only; it remains a substantial water rating. On either watch, current pressure resistance depends on seals, assembly and testing.

A pre-owned watch should pass an appropriate pressure test before swimming or diving. Do not use the factory rating as a substitute for a current test.
Calibre 17 or Manufacture B31

Reserve, date and presentation are the meaningful differences

Breitling 17 in the selected Superocean is an automatic calibre with approximately 38 hours of reserve. The exact Superocean is deliberately date-free, preserving a highly legible dial.

Manufacture B31 in the selected Heritage is an automatic three-hand/date calibre with approximately 78 hours of reserve. Breitling presents it through a sapphire display back. The longer reserve is useful for rotation, while the date changes the dial and daily interaction.

Two 42 mm watches that do not wear alike

Thickness and attachment change the silhouette

The Heritage B31 is 0.53 mm thinner by the published figures. Its integrated mesh attachment hugs the case visually, while the Superocean's three-row bracelet and bolder dive-watch geometry create a more overt tool-watch profile.

The interfaces are close but not identical: 22 mm for the Superocean and 22.05 mm for the Heritage. Buy replacement parts by full reference. Do not assume a strap or bracelet can cross between the families.

Two chapters of Breitling sea-watch history

Slow Motion clarity versus 1957 waterfront style

Modern Superocean recalls the pared-down Slow Motion dive-watch language of the 1960s: high contrast, broad luminous elements and a design stripped toward underwater legibility. The exact 42 mm reference uses a ceramic-inlaid bezel and steel bracelet.

Superocean Heritage reaches back to Breitling's 1957 Ref. 1004 and Ref. 807 sea watches. The current B31 generation retains the arrow-and-spear hand language, ceramic-inlaid bezel and mesh attachment while adding a modern manufacture movement.

Pre-owned inspection

Test the dive hardware and identify the exact generation

Check bezel action and alignment, crown threads, crystal and anti-reflective coating, bracelet articulation, clasp and all supplied links. Inspect the Heritage mesh carefully where it meets the case and clasp.

  1. Match the full reference and serial to the watch and available records.
  2. Confirm whether the dial should have a date for that exact reference.
  3. Test winding, setting, date change where applicable and power reserve.
  4. Inspect bezel insert, lume, hands and dial for impact or moisture evidence.
  5. Request service history and a recent pressure-test result.
  6. Do not infer a manufacture calibre from the collection name alone; verify the exact reference.

Frequently asked questions

Superocean versus Superocean Heritage FAQs

Which exact watch has the higher water-resistance rating?

Superocean A17375211B1A1 is rated to 300 m; Superocean Heritage B31 AB3111241B1A1 is rated to 200 m.

Which exact reference has the longer power reserve?

The Heritage's Manufacture B31 is rated to approximately 78 hours versus approximately 38 hours for Breitling 17 in the Superocean.

Are both watches the same diameter?

Yes. Both exact references are 42 mm, but the Heritage is thinner at 12.03 mm versus 12.56 mm.

Do both exact references have a date?

No. The selected Superocean is date-free; the selected Heritage B31 has a date aperture at 6 o'clock.

Do both use unidirectional bezels and screw-locked crowns?

Yes. Breitling specifies a unidirectional ratcheted bezel and screw-locked crown with two gaskets for each exact reference.

Is Superocean Heritage only a dress watch?

No. The exact Heritage B31 is rated to 200 m and has dive-watch hardware, but its thinner case and integrated mesh emphasize a more heritage-led presentation.
